Ramesh earned his B.Sc. and M.Sc. degrees in Physics from Tribhuvan University, and a Ph.D. from Wake Forest University with a thesis titled "Modeling Excitations in Quantum Magnets". His doctoral research primarily focuses on building low energy model Hamiltonians to understand spin-phonon interactions in magnetic insulators and quantitatively estimating their consequences for experiments, such as spectroscopy and the thermal Hall effect. Ramesh Joined the group in July 2026. His research interests include non-linear spin phonon interactions and chiral phonons.
